Output 76a97a845bb2619422f033e522cf5b5319cf8a67b6ec94e23a91fd4cd7f33712:14

value
584000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e344edae556650716b92969ca88e33986c76e5f OP_EQUAL
address
37MvUrzRAd2Mf3jbixRHoBjCJFBiihb6Ux
transaction
76a97a845bb2619422f033e522cf5b5319cf8a67b6ec94e23a91fd4cd7f33712
confirmations
294133
spent
true